Factors that affect the amount of settlement for wrongful Death

The amount of compensation awarded in a mesothelioma suit for the wrongful death of a victim is based on the extent of exposure to asbestos and severity of the condition. The amount of compensation is also influenced by the amount of financial loss incurred by the victim's family. These losses could include funeral expenses and future income loss medical expenses, pain and discomfort. Families of victims may also be awarded punitive damages.

Lawyers for mesothelioma must also prove the defendants in the lawsuit negligently exposed their client to asbestos. This can be done using a variety sources, including documents from work, testimony from coworkers or former military service members, and other documentation.

After this evidence has been collected, lawyers must analyze the losses of the victim to determine the total award they are entitled to. This includes a lifetime's worth of lost wages and other benefits the victim could have received in the event they were alive. To determine this amount, attorneys employ bank statements and pay stubs from several years ago and employ experts like economists or actuaries.

A knowledgeable mesothelioma lawyer will fight for the maximum compensation for their client's estate. If the defense refuses to accept a settlement, the case will be taken to trial.

The majority of mesothelioma related death claims are settled before reaching the trial stage. This is due to the fact that most lawyers prefer to settle cases instead of risk losing them at a jury trial, which could result in no compensation for the family of the victim.

The Damages Amount

The amount of money paid in a settlement is divided into several kinds of damages. There are economic and noneconomic damages. Economic damages can be quantified in terms of concrete numbers like treatment costs or lost wages. Noneconomic damages are are more difficult to quantify, such as suffering and pain.

The money received from a mesothelioma case can be used to pay funeral expenses, medical bills, and other financial requirements. It can also provide family members peace of mind, and a feeling that they will be financially secure in the future.

To ensure that victims receive the maximum amount of compensation, they should speak with an expert mesothelioma lawyer. An attorney can review the case and determine which factors will most influence the final settlement amount.

A mesothelioma lawsuit is usually divided into different types of damages. These include the reimbursement of medical expenses, funeral expenses, lost income as well as pain and suffering. In some cases, families may also receive punitive damages to try to punish the asbestos companies for their negligence.
